A gorgeous labrador named Fred and his big family resides in Mountfitchet Castle. The adorable puppy owners, Jo and Jeremy, are animal lovers who have taken in a number of rescued animals. Because of this, Fred took on the role of a big brother to all the animals who had through horrible and painful circumstances.
He frequently stood by their side, supporting and defending them. One day, nine baby ducklings were found wandering around the area around the castle without their mother. The staff at the castle thought that was strange and started looking about for the mother of the ducklings. The crew came to the conclusion that she might have been a fox’s victim when the search turned up nothing.

They accepted the smaller animals into their larger brood out of concern that they would meet the same fate. When Fred first came into contact with the ducklings, he responded in an unusual way. He started to take care of them by enclosing them in his paw. The ducklings believe the dog is their father and follow him wherever he goes.
Along with eating and sleeping together, they often go swimming in the nearby pond.
